The Battery-Powered Surprise
The surprise wasn't the price difference. It was the fact that a Fronius cordless welder exists. I had never considered a battery-powered welding machine for anything beyond small spot repairs. That belief comes from an era when battery units were weak. This is not that. According to Fronius's published specs on fronius.com, the AccuPocket line is a battery-powered welding system designed for maintenance and remote work. I checked that as of February 2025, about a month before we signed the order.
People on the shop floor call it a wireless welding machine. It's wireless in the sense that it doesn't need a wall outlet. You still have a torch cable and ground clamp, but when you're working on a trailer in a gravel lot, not needing the grid is the whole point.
The Aluminum Reality Check
While I was excited about the battery unit, Dan kept saying the same thing: 'What about aluminum?' So we looked at the Fronius aluminum MIG welder with a push-pull torch. Aluminum MIG is unforgiving. If the arc stutters or the wire feed lags, you get a dirty weld and a lot of grinding. The demo surprised me. The machine laid down a clean bead on 1/8-inch aluminum and kept it consistent. No spatter everywhere. No half-started weld. Dan looked at me and said, 'This is the one.'
Turning Standard Into Custom
One thing I didn't anticipate was how much custom welding equipment, or at least custom configuration, matters. The dealer didn't just hand us a price list. They asked about duty cycle, material thickness, torch length, and how we planned to power the machine at customer sites. The package we ended up quoting included a specific torch package, a consumables kit, and a compact cart. None of it was a bespoke machine, but it felt custom because it matched our work.
What 'Wire Welding Machine Price' Really Means
Here's the part finance and I went back and forth on. The wire welding machine price range for the machines we considered was wide. I'd say roughly $1,500 for a basic unit, up to $5,000 or more for a package with the features we needed. Don't hold me to those numbers; they're from a January 2025 dealer quote and prices change. The real issue wasn't the sticker. It was the total cost of ownership.
We bought a less expensive inverter MIG two years earlier. On steel, it was fine. On aluminum, it gave Dan headaches. The rework and grinding time probably cost us more than the price difference. Switching to the right machine cut our average repair turnaround from two days to one. I'm not 100% sure of the exact percentage, but the schedule stopped slipping.
